About Arconic

Arconic produces aluminum sheets, plates, extrusions, and architectural products for the ground transportation, aerospace, building and construction, industrial, and packaging industries. Rolled Products, Extrusions, and Building and Construction Systems (BCS) are the company's operating segments. The Rolled Products segment generates the majority of its revenue, which is used in the production of finished goods ranging from automotive body panels and airframes to industrial plate and brazing sheets.
